QSFP28 modules provide a cost-effective, high-density 100G solution for routers and optical networks, supporting distances from a few meters to 300 km depending on the module type.Overview of QSFP28 TechnologyQSFP28 (Quad Small Form-factor Pluggable 28) is a hot-pluggable optical transceiver designed for 100 Gigabit Ethernet (100GbE) connectivity. It aggregates four 25G lanes to achieve 100G throughput, offering high port density and lower power consumption compared to older 100G form factors like CFP2/CFP4 . QSFP28 modules are widely used in data centers, enterprise core networks, and telecom infrastructure, making them ideal for high-capacity links in Senegalese networks .Cost-Effective Deployment OptionsShort-Reach Links (Within Rack or Campus)QSFP28 SR4: Uses 8 MMF fibers, supports distances up to 100 meters.Direct-Attach Copper (DAC) or Active Optical Cables (AOC): Very cost-effective for distances up to a few meters, ideal for ToR (leaf) to aggregation (spine) connections .Medium-Reach Links (Metro or Campus Interconnects)QSFP28 LR4: Single-mode module with 4 WDM wavelengths, supports up to 10 km.Suitable for connecting buildings or data centers within a city like Dakar, offering a balance of cost and reach .Long-Reach Links (Metro or Regional Networks)Cisco QSFP28 100G ZR: Coherent optics module capable of 80 km over dark fiber and up to 300 km over amplified DWDM links.Cost-effective for upgrading multiple 10G wavelengths to 100G without replacing existing fiber infrastructure .Supports low latency and precise timing, ideal for wireless x-haul, campus interconnects, and data center interconnects .Key Considerations for SenegalFiber Type: Ensure compatibility with existing single-mode or multi-mode fiber. SR4 is for MMF, LR4/ZR for SMF.Power Budget: QSFP28 modules consume 4–6W depending on temperature and type, which is efficient for dense deployments .Interoperability: QSFP28 modules follow IEEE 802.3bm/802.3cd standards and CMIS 5.2, ensuring multi-vendor compatibility .Scalability: QSFP28 allows seamless upgrades from 40G to 100G without redesigning switch hardware, reducing long-term costs .RecommendationsFor intra-data center links, use SR4 or DAC/AOC modules to minimize cost.For city-wide or campus networks, LR4 modules provide a cost-effective 10 km reach.For regional or metro backbone links, 100G ZR coherent modules offer long-distance connectivity with minimal fiber upgrades, making them the most cost-effective solution for high-capacity routes . By selecting the appropriate QSFP28 module type based on distance and deployment scenario, network operators in Senegal can achieve high-speed 100G connectivity while optimizing cost, power, and port density.
